A student’s team of Erasmus School of Economics has won the Dutch finals of the Accuracy Business Cup and will proudly represent the Netherlands at the international finals in Paris on 10 April.
Master's students in Strategy Economics Sanya Garg (India), Andrea Romero Millan (Mexico) and Maria Clara Leoni Guimarães (Brazil) took successfully part in the Dutch competition. According to Sanya Garg, it was a rigorous test of financial analysis and strategic thinking. ‘From conducting an in-depth valuation of Danone’s waters division to pitching an acquisition strategy for its specialised nutrition segment, the experience was truly invaluable’, she says.
The Accuracy Business Cup is an international student competition, which gives the opportunity to work on financial and strategic business cases. In the national rounds of this year’s edition, 711 teams fiercely competed under the supervision of Accuracy consultants.
Sanya, Andrea and Maria will go up against the winners of the other countries during the international final in Paris on 10 April.
